Title :
Optimization of pulse regeneration by self-phase modulation in fibers

Abstract :
We investigate the effects of fiber length, launch power, and filter offset on the performance of an all-fiber 2R regenerator based on self-phase modulation. Experimental verification at 40 Gbit/s is demonstrated.
